Liberty Insurance Company processes application forms. The average output in a week is 600 claims. Currently the staff includes six full-time employees who work 40 hours per week and earn $18 per hour including fringe benefits. Management has invested in computer technology that has a weekly cost of $1,200. Materials and energy are not used in significant amounts.
a. What is the productivity of the application process?
b. Suppose Liberty decides to invest in additional computer equipment that will drive the weekly cost of information technology to $1,800. One of the application evaluators is retiring and will not be replaced. The remaining five processors should be able to do 650 applications per week with the new technology. What is the impact on productivity (please give both the new productivity ratio and the percentage change in productivity from part a)?
